      A valve refusing to close completely disables that cylinder instantly, doesn't sound like it from your description. Normally I would expect normal behavior from the good cylinder and severe misfiring from the bad one.
      A carburetor without an accelerator pump (all Linkert) will have slow or bad snap response if it's lean.
      A useful test (if it repeats): compression test will show very low on the bad cylinder as long as the valve is stuck, and a big jump if it frees up.

                    Fizz!

                    Greer's nuts are excellent.

                    As far as PEEK seals, I pioneered its use: http://virtualindian.org/9techpeek.htm
                    (Please note that my prices went up in eighteen years...)

                    That was published before it became obvious that mass-production was impractical, as nearly all vintage manifolds are worn upon the spigots, and even new reproductions didn't match.

                    The material is phenomenal, when properly fitted.
                    Reuseability depends very much upon the finish on the manifold's spigots.
                    Like any seal, an occasional snugging of the nuts is prudent, particularly after the first few heat cycles. Over-tightening should be avoided.

                    Other than the nut bevel issue, the only two failures reported to me on Chiefs both had oiling issues, that apparently spiked temperatures near 600°F.
                    Most folks would notice.

                      If you are actually losing only one cylinder (for whatever reason) the spark plug, piston, and head temperature of the "good" cylinder will rise quickly since it's carrying the entire load, and will be prone to heat (not lubrication) -related seizure. Be careful!
                      Complete secondary electrical failure (no spark at all) kills the motor dead, but weak spark may continue to fire the cylinder with the lower cylinder pressure (in psi) especially at low throttle openings (and go dead at WOT). After a few seconds, the working pipe will be hotter and of course louder (the cold cylinder will just release compression when the exhaust valve opens, not combustion).
